Direct to Garment (DTG) Printing โ€“ vivid detail with a soft finish

DTG printing applies garment-safe inks directly onto the fabric with a high-precision inkjet process. Because the ink bonds into the fibers, you get clean lines, rich color and a comfortable feelโ€”no thick, rubbery layer.

? Sharp detail for complex art

Great for intricate illustrations, tiny text, gradients and photo-style prints.

? Soft, breathable feel

Ink sinks in instead of sitting on topโ€”comfortable for daily wear.

โœ… Reliable longevity

With proper washing, prints remain vibrant without cracking or peeling.

When DTG is the right choice

  • You want a custom, unique design (even 1 piece).
  • You need small quantities without screen setup costs.
  • Your artwork includes photos, gradients or many colors.
  • You prefer a soft, natural print look and feel.

Tips for the best print quality

  • Best results on cotton and high-cotton garments.
  • Dark shirts use a white base layer for extra vibrancy.
  • Durability depends on curing and proper garment care.
  • Send high-resolution artwork for crisp detail.
Wash & care: Turn inside out, wash at 30ยฐC / 86ยฐF, avoid bleach, and skip tumble drying. Iron inside out (or through a cloth) to keep prints looking fresh.
Is DTG suitable for 1โ€“5 shirts?

Yes โ€” DTG is perfect for single pieces and small batches because thereโ€™s no costly setup like screen printing.

What does โ€œno crack & peelโ€ mean?

Since the ink bonds into the fabric, there isnโ€™t a thick layer on top that can crack or peel.

Can DTG print photos?

Definitely โ€” DTG handles photo detail, gradients and full-color images extremely well.

Does DTG feel heavy on the shirt?

Usually it feels soft. On dark garments, the white underbase can add a slightly fuller feel, but it stays comfortable.
